Rocking Star Yash makes a bold return to the big screen in *Toxic: A Fairytale for Grown-Ups*, a gangster action thriller set in Goa’s crime-ridden underworld spanning the 1940s to the 1970s. The film, co-written and starring Yash as Raya, features intense action sequences, betrayal, and a fierce protagonist determined to dismantle his enemies. A newly released teaser highlights Raya’s ruthless demeanor, with Yash delivering memorable lines like, “It’s over, when I say it’s over,” while showcasing grand visuals, including a Royal Circus setting and a chainsaw-wielding climax.
Directed by Geetu Mohandas, the film explores themes of smuggling routes, crime gangs, and fear, with Raya navigating a treacherous world where survival is doubtful if he defies powerful forces. The teaser hints at mercyless killings and grandiose sequences, setting the tone for a gripping narrative filled with twists and turns. Set against the backdrop of historical Goa, *Toxic* delves into the darker side of power, fear, and betrayal, offering a unique take on the gangster genre.
The film boasts an impressive cast, including Nayanthara as Ganga, Kiara Advani as Nadia, Huma Qureshi as Elizabeth, Tara Sutaria as Rebecca, and Rukimi Vasanth as Mellisa.
